Apostille

An apostille is a special stamp certifying the authenticity of a signature, seal, and position of the person who signed a document, for use abroad. In the context of Russian visas, an apostille may be required to legalize documents (e.g., marriage certificate for a private invitation). Russia is a party to the 1961 Hague Convention.
